  • Patent number: 7606434
    Abstract: An apparatus and a method for forming a data structure that improves error resilience when applied to the coding of hierarchical subband decomposed coefficients, e.g., wavelet transform coefficients. The texture unit is defined as comprising only those AC transform coefficients that are located in one or more slices in a single subband. The texture unit is defined as comprising only those AC transform coefficients that are across “n” subbands, where “n” is smaller number than the total number of “N” levels of decomposition. A texture unit can also be defined as comprising only those bits from the DC transform coefficients that form a single bitplane.

  • Patent number: 7363157
    Abstract: A method and apparatus for performing wide area terrain mapping. The system comprises a digital elevation map (DEM) and mosaic generation engine that processes images that are simultaneously captured by an electro-optical camera (RGB camera) and a LIDAR sensor. The image data collected by both the camera and the LIDAR sensor are processed to create a geometrically accurate three-dimensional view of objects viewed from an aerial platform.

  • Patent number: 6526175
    Abstract: An apparatus and a concomitant method for packetizing significance-based information to improve error resilience is disclosed. Significance-based information comprises “coefficient significance information”. Within each packet, the “coefficient significance information” are coded first into a first or front portion of the packet and then the “coefficient values” are coded into a second or back portion of the packet.

  • Patent number: 6487319
    Abstract: An apparatus and a method for identifying the spatial location of a coding unit, e.g., a texture unit (TU), in a hierarchically decomposed image. Specifically, the invention quickly computes and identifies the “starting point” of a texture unit, by using the texture unit number and the width and height of the “DC” band.

  • Patent number: 6269192
    Abstract: An apparatus and a concomitant method is disclosed for encoding wavelet trees to generate bitstreams with flexible degrees of spatial, quality and complexity scalabilities. The zerotree entropy (ZTE) encoding method is extended to achieve a fully scalable coding method by implementing a multiscale zerotree coding scheme.

  • Patent number: 6137915
    Abstract: An apparatus and a method for concealing errors in a hierarchical subband coding/decoding system. Specifically, error concealment of a corrupted or missing coefficient is achieved by using uncorrupted coefficient(s) or a window of coefficients corresponding to the same spatial location from other subbands.
